通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

需求管理理论体系包括什么

需求管理理论体系包括什么

需求管理理论体系包括需求识别、需求分析、需求规划、需求验证与确认、以及需求变更管理。这些环节相互关联、循环往复,共同构成了一个完整的需求管理流程。在详细描述中,我将重点展开讲解需求识别,因为这是需求管理的起点,也是整个项目成功与否的关键因素。

一、需求识别

需求识别是指在项目启动初期,通过与利益相关者的沟通、市场调研、目标群体分析等方式,收集项目相关的需求信息。这一过程的目标是明确和记录下来所有可能影响项目的需求,这些需求可能来自于项目的直接用户、项目赞助人、法律法规等。

首先, 需要与利益相关者进行广泛的沟通。这包括用户访谈、焦点小组、工作坊、问卷调查等方法。这个环节的重点是要确保所有的声音都被听到,哪怕是那些最初看起来不那么重要的意见,因为它们可能在后期变得非常关键。

其次, 应该进行市场调研,了解行业趋势、竞争对手的产品特性,以及市场上的未满足需求。这有助于把握市场动态,预测未来的需求变化,从而使产品保持竞争优势。

最后, 对目标群体进行分析,了解他们的具体需求和期望。可以通过用户画像的方式,构建典型用户的行为特征、需求偏好等,以此为依据进行需求收集和分析。

二、需求分析

在需求分析阶段,将对收集到的需求进行详细的审查和评估。这一阶段的目的是确保需求的完整性、一致性、实现性和相关性。

首先, 需要对需求进行分类。将需求分为功能需求和非功能需求,功能需求关注系统“能做什么”,而非功能需求关注系统“如何做到的”。例如,安全性、性能、可用性等通常属于非功能需求。

其次, 进行需求优先级的划分。根据项目目标、资源限制、风险评估等因素,将需求分为“必须做”、“应该做”、“可以做”和“不做”的四个等级。这有助于项目团队集中精力先实现最关键的需求。

此外, 还需要对需求进行可行性分析,包括技术可行性、经济可行性和运营可行性。这一步骤能确保提出的需求不仅是被用户所期望的,而且是可以实现的,并且在经济上是合理的。

三、需求规划

需求规划是在需求分析基础上,制定如何满足这些需求的策略和计划。这包括需求的实施顺序、资源分配以及时间安排等。

首先, 制定需求实施的时间表。这包括确定需求实现的先后顺序、设置里程碑和预计完成时间。这个过程需要考虑到项目的资源限制和风险管理,确保时间表的合理性和可行性。

其次, 进行资源分配。根据项目需求和时间表,合理分配人力、物力、财力等资源。这需要项目管理者具备良好的判断能力和决策能力,以确保资源的高效利用。

四、需求验证与确认

需求验证与确认的目的是确保需求被正确理解和实施,并且符合利益相关者的真正意图和需求。这个过程通常包括需求评审、原型设计评估和用户验收测试等。

首先, 通过需求评审会议来确认需求文档的准确性和完整性。在这个会议中,需求管理者、项目团队成员和利益相关者共同检查需求文档,确保没有遗漏或误解。

其次, 原型设计评估。通过原型或模拟系统的方式,让用户实际体验产品功能,收集他们的反馈,以验证需求是否得到了正确的解决。

五、需求变更管理

在项目实施过程中,需求变更是不可避免的。需求变更管理的目的是确保变更得到有效控制,避免项目范围蔓延、预算增加和时间延误。

首先, 建立一个明确的变更请求流程。当有新的需求或现有需求发生变化时,利益相关者应该通过这个流程提交变更请求。

其次, 对变更请求进行评估。这涉及到对变更的影响、必要性和优先级进行分析,以及对项目范围、预算和时间表的可能影响进行评估。

需求管理理论体系是项目管理中的关键组成部分,它涉及到项目成功的各个环节。从需求识别开始,到需求分析、规划、验证以及变更管理,每个阶段都需要细致的工作和严密的控制,以确保项目按照利益相关者的需求进行,并最终实现项目目标。通过有效的需求管理,可以最大限度地减少浪费、提升项目成功率,并满足用户的实际需求。

相关问答FAQs:

1. 什么是需求管理理论体系?
需求管理理论体系是指一套用于管理和满足需求的理论框架和方法。它包括了对需求识别、需求分析、需求评估、需求优先级排序以及需求变更管理等方面的理论和实践。

2. 需求管理理论体系的主要组成部分有哪些?
需求管理理论体系主要包括需求识别、需求分析、需求评估、需求优先级排序和需求变更管理等几个重要环节。其中,需求识别是指从用户和相关利益相关者中收集和确认需求;需求分析是指对需求进行深入研究和分析,以确保需求的准确性和完整性;需求评估是指对需求的可行性和价值进行评估,以确定哪些需求是最重要的;需求优先级排序是指按照重要性和紧急性对需求进行排序;需求变更管理是指在需求变更时如何进行管理和控制。

3. 需求管理理论体系的应用有哪些优势?
需求管理理论体系的应用有许多优势。首先,它可以帮助组织更好地理解用户需求,从而设计出更符合用户期望的产品或服务。其次,它可以帮助组织更好地规划和管理项目,确保项目按时交付、符合预算和质量要求。此外,需求管理理论体系还可以帮助组织更好地与利益相关者进行沟通和协调,提高项目的成功率。最后,它还可以帮助组织更好地进行需求变更管理,及时应对变化,提高项目的适应性和灵活性。

相关文章